The Number System in the context of RRB NTPC (Railway Recruitment Board Non-Technical Popular Categories) 2024 refers to the mathematical framework that helps in representing and understanding different kinds of numbers and their relationships. It covers various types of numbers such as natural numbers, whole numbers, integers, rational and irrational numbers. These numbers form the basis for performing arithmetic operations and solving complex problems, which are commonly tested in the Railway Recruitment exam. In the exam, candidates can expect questions that assess their ability to work with numbers, identify properties of different types of numbers, and solve problems related to factors, multiples, divisibility, and number operations like add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division. Understanding concepts such as prime factorization, Least Common Multiple (LCM), Highest Common Factor (HCF), and number bases (like binary and decimal) is also critical. Mastery of these concepts is essential for performing well in the mathematics section of the RRB NTPC exam.
